Authorities have identified persons of interest in the killing of a former employee of the National Irrigation Administration-Northern Mindanao (NIA-10) and raised the possibility that the motorcycle-riding assailants were professional gun-for-hire killers.

The victim, Niruh Kyle Antatico, was shot dead while driving his car in Barangay Patag, Cagayan de Oro City on Friday, October 10, 2025.

A special investigation task group (SITG) has been formed composed of personnel from various law enforcement agencies to investigate the incident.

NIA has already offered a P100,000 reward for information leading to the identification and arrest of the gunmen and the mastermind.

One of the possible motives being investigated by authorities is the victim’s alleged exposés on corruption involving NIA projects in Lanao del Sur.
